Salt spray is best used on wet or damp hair before applying something heavier. The salt acts like a dry shampoo to absorb grease, and delivers a textured look that you usually only get from a day at the beach. Wax delivers a firm-yet-pliable hold with moderate amounts of shine, although the finish can vary from product to product. More pliable than gel and hair spray, wax can be restyled as desired and won’t harden. Thickening shampoos use proteins to penetrate and coat your hair, making each strand expand (because remember, your hair is basically just protein anyway). In terms of styling, try applying a small amount of styling cream to damp hair, then blow it dry with low heat and low air. Don’t use a brush; just run your fingers through your hair as you blow it dry. Also experiment with texture powders, which offer a noticeable increase in perceived thickness.

You can add a cream to your hair while it’s damp, and then blow it dry for volume, or apply it when your hair is already dry for added texture. Creams not only add moisture and body to your hair, but they’re perfect for creating that natural look; that is, the look like you’re not using any product at all. If your hair is dry, and you suffer from rampant flyaways, a cream is a great choice for keeping your hair tame. Keep in mind though that creams, by themselves, don’t offer much hold.

Know this about fiber—it’s a no-nonsense styling product for men who don’t want their hair to budge even slightly during the day. With fiber, your hold remains locked in until you wash the fiber out.

The problem is that oil-based pomades are difficult to wash out, aren’t good for your hair, your scalp, hell, they’re not even good for your comb. Water-based pomades, while not quite as strong, will still offer decent hold, are easy to wash out, and are lighter weight.
